Description
A double-fronted, three-bedroom mid-terrace house occupying an elevated position within a popular residential area.
Tenure: Freehold - EPC: C - Council Tax: B
Conveniently situated within walking distance of Colwyn Bay town centre and its wide range of amenities.
The accommodation comprises an entrance porch, small hallway with staircase, lounge, dining room and kitchen. To the first floor are three bedrooms and a family bathroom. The property benefits from gas-fired central heating and uPVC double glazing, although some modernisation is required.
Outside are mainly hard-landscaped gardens to the front and rear, including attractive flagstone paving and a useful garden store. A brick-paved hardstanding provides off-road parking.
Ideal first time or investment opportunity.

*Guide Price: An indication of a seller's minimum expectation at auction and given as a Guide Price or a range of Guide Prices. This is not necessarily the figure a property will sell for and is subject to change prior to the auction.
Reserve Price: Each auction property will be subject to a Reserve Price below which the property cannot be sold at auction. Normally the Reserve Price will be set within the range of Guide Prices or no more than 10% above a single Guide Price.
